Local ground conditions in Linn Grove
Iowa winters bring frost to roughly 48" of depth around Linn Grove, so cold-weather digs here often favor air excavation or heated-water hydrovac to work frozen ground. Linn Grove sits in a continental climate with cold winters, which sets the seasonal window for excavation here. Ground around Linn Grove runs to clay, loam and sandy loam, which shapes how quickly water- or air-based excavation cuts and how the spoil is handled. Before you dig in Linn Grove
Iowa One Call is the one-call service that protects buried utilities across Iowa; call 811 before excavation near Linn Grove. Iowa requires 48 hours advance notice. The service providers we match you with treat utility location as a non-negotiable part of every dig.

Which type of vacuum truck do I need for my job in Linn Grove?
It depends on the work: hydrovac and air vacuum trucks dig safely around utilities, combo trucks clean sewers and pipes, and liquid or liquid-ring units recover fluids and slurry. Describe your Linn Grove job and we match it to service providers with the right equipment.
